Position Overview

We are seeking an experienced Registered Nurse (RN) with an active, unencumbered Texas license to join our clinical oversight team.

This is a non-bedside role. RNs do not provide direct hands-on care to clients. Instead, they serve in a supervisory and clinical assessment capacity, supporting caregivers and ensuring client care needs are accurately evaluated and documented.

    Primary Responsibilities
  • Complete standard nursing assessments, including health status reviews, vitals, functional observations, and care plan evaluations.
  • Conduct assigned insurance-related assessments for clients receiving home health services through insurance providers, including evaluating and documenting medical necessity and health validity for services.
  • Review and validate client conditions to support continued eligibility for services when required by insurers or care programs.
  • Provide clinical oversight and supervision of caregivers, including care guidance, observation, and documentation review.
  • Communicate assessment findings to care coordinators, families, and internal leadership as needed.
  • Ensure compliance with agency policies, documentation standards, and applicable regulatory requirements.
  • Maintain accurate, timely clinical documentation in agency systems.
    What This Role Is NOT
  • No direct patient care or bedside nursing
  • No wound care, injections, medication administration, or hands-on ADLs
  • No shift-based bedside assignments

This role is focused on clinical evaluation, oversight, and documentation.
